Robert Stanley Grodis, age 83, resident of Waterbury, beloved husband to Faith Rowe Grodis, passed away on Sunday, March 31, 2013 at St. Mary’s Hospital in Waterbury. Born in Pittston, PA on June 5, 1929, he was the son of the late Stanley and Mary Dudavich Grodis. He served with pride and honor in the US Air Force during the Korean Conflict. Bob was employed with the Department of the Defense at Sikorsky as a Navy Quality Control inspector. He was a dedicated member of the Stratford Knights of Columbus and the Republican Town Committee in Stratford. An avid fisherman and devoted sportsman, Bob will be greatly missed by all who knew him.
In addition to his wife, Faith, he is survived by four daughters, Suzanne Grodis Bozsar of Naugatuck, Mary Grodis Leonard of Waterbury, Catherine Grodis of Bristol and Bobbi L. Pina of Bridgeport and his step-son Steven Conley; eight grandchildren, Ronnie, Damon, Kurt, Shannon, Brittany, Janessa, Peter, Jr., and Elijah and six great grandchildren, Damon, Jr., Destiny, Alex, Gabriella, Joshua, Ji’Yanna and his beloved dog, Pookie and other loving family members. He was predeceased by his first wife, Patricia Ann Murphy Grodis.
